The Siesta and the Chaupal: In rural India, the afternoon heat brings a lifestyle shift: the siesta. But as the sun sets, the village chaupal (central square) wakes up. This is where folklore is passed down. Grandfathers narrate tales of the Mahabharata not as mythology, but as family history. The chaupal is the original Netflix, where every episode ends with a moral and a prophecy.
If you want to see India at its most vibrant, look at its festivals. But the real stories aren't just in the big fireworks. They are in the local community "Pandals" during Durga Puja, where strangers become family while sharing a meal, or the quiet lighting of an oil lamp during Diwali that signifies hope over despair.
